DownloaderBaba - all in one stock image downloader
3,651 Behind the scenes Videos, Royalty-free Stock Behind the scenes Footage | Depositphotos

Understanding How Depositphotos Works Behind the Scenes

January 12, 2024
87 0

Depositphotos stands as a versatile and comprehensive platform, offering a diverse range of digital content to meet the creative needs of users across the globe. Let’s dive into the key aspects that define Depositphotos:

  • Content Variety: Depositphotos boasts a vast and ever-growing collection that spans high-quality images, videos, illustrations, and vectors. With millions of files available, users can find content suitable for diverse projects and themes.
  • Global Reach: Serving a global audience, Depositphotos provides a bridge for content creators and consumers worldwide. This international accessibility allows users to tap into a rich repository of culturally diverse visuals.
  • Flexible Licensing: Depositphotos offers flexible licensing options, allowing users to choose the right plan based on their specific needs. Whether it’s for personal use, commercial projects, or large-scale campaigns, Depositphotos provides licensing solutions to accommodate different requirements.
  • Search and Discovery: The platform’s intuitive search and discovery features empower users to find the perfect content efficiently. Advanced filters, categories, and keyword searches ensure a seamless browsing experience, helping users locate precisely what they’re looking for.
  • Subscription Plans: Depositphotos provides subscription plans that cater to various usage levels. From occasional users to businesses with frequent content needs, these plans offer a cost-effective way to access and download high-quality files without compromising on quality.
  • Instant Downloads: Users can enjoy the convenience of instant downloads, ensuring quick access to the desired content. This feature is particularly valuable for time-sensitive projects and campaigns.

Whether you’re a graphic designer, marketer, blogger, or simply someone looking for captivating visuals, Depositphotos offers a user-friendly platform that simplifies the process of sourcing and using digital content. The platform’s commitment to quality, variety, and accessibility positions it as a valuable resource in the realm of digital creativity.

Content Collection Process

Behind the scenes of outdoor video production Stock Photo by ┬ęgnepphoto 179178382

Understanding the meticulous process behind building Depositphotos‘ extensive content library provides valuable insights into the platform’s commitment to quality and diversity. Here’s a closer look at the content collection process:

  • Contributor Network: Depositphotos collaborates with a vast network of talented contributors, including photographers, videographers, and illustrators from around the world. This diverse community ensures a broad spectrum of content styles and subjects.
  • Content Submission: Contributors submit their work to Depositphotos, adhering to the platform’s guidelines and quality standards. This step involves rigorous checks to maintain the overall quality of the content available to users.
  • Review and Approval: Depositphotos employs a thorough review process to assess the submitted content. This includes evaluating technical aspects, adherence to licensing requirements, and overall aesthetic quality. Only approved content makes its way into the platform’s library.
  • Metadata and Tagging: To enhance searchability, each piece of content undergoes meticulous metadata tagging. This includes relevant keywords, categories, and descriptions, ensuring that users can easily discover and access the content they need.
  • Curation and Diversity: Depositphotos places a premium on offering diverse and inclusive content. The curation process involves selecting content that represents a wide range of themes, styles, and cultural perspectives, catering to the varied needs of a global audience.

Furthermore, Depositphotos maintains a dynamic approach to content collection, regularly updating its library to stay abreast of evolving trends and user preferences. The platform’s dedication to fostering a vibrant and expansive collection underscores its role as a go-to resource for creative professionals seeking high-quality visuals for their projects.

Licensing and Usage Rights

Understanding the licensing and usage rights on Depositphotos is crucial for users looking to leverage the platform’s diverse content for their projects. Let’s delve into the key aspects of licensing and usage:

  • Types of Licenses: Depositphotos offers various types of licenses to cater to different usage scenarios. These may include standard licenses for general purposes, extended licenses for broader usage rights, and more specialized licenses for unique requirements.
  • Commercial and Editorial Use: Users can choose licenses based on whether their intended use is commercial or editorial. Commercial licenses are suitable for promotional and advertising purposes, while editorial licenses are geared towards news reporting, educational content, and other non-commercial uses.
  • Permitted and Prohibited Uses: Depositphotos clearly outlines the permitted and prohibited uses of its content in its licensing agreements. Understanding these terms ensures that users comply with copyright laws and respect the intellectual property rights of content creators.
  • Exclusive vs. Non-Exclusive Licensing: Depositphotos provides both exclusive and non-exclusive licensing options. Exclusive licenses grant the buyer exclusive rights to use the content, while non-exclusive licenses allow multiple users to license and use the same content concurrently.
License TypeIntended UsePermissions
Standard LicenseGeneral purposes (e.g., websites, social media, print)Limited to a single user or organization
Extended LicenseBroader usage rights (e.g., merchandise, TV and film)May allow for unlimited reproductions

By carefully selecting the appropriate license for their needs, users can confidently and legally incorporate Depositphotos’ content into their projects. It’s crucial to review and understand the licensing terms associated with each piece of content to ensure compliance and avoid any potential legal issues.

Behind the Technology

Delving into the technological infrastructure that powers Depositphotos unveils the sophisticated systems and innovations driving this renowned digital content platform. Here’s a closer look at the technology that makes Depositphotos a seamless and efficient hub for creative assets:

  • Advanced Search Algorithms: Depositphotos employs cutting-edge search algorithms that enable users to find relevant content swiftly. The platform’s search functionality incorporates machine learning and image recognition technologies, ensuring accurate and efficient results.
  • Cloud-Based Storage: Leveraging cloud-based storage solutions, Depositphotos ensures the scalability and accessibility of its vast content library. This technology allows users to access high-resolution files instantly without compromising on download speeds or performance.
  • Responsive Design: The platform is designed with responsiveness in mind, adapting seamlessly to various devices and screen sizes. This ensures an optimal user experience whether accessing Depositphotos from a desktop, tablet, or smartphone.
  • Security Measures: Depositphotos prioritizes the security of user data and content. Robust encryption protocols and cybersecurity measures safeguard the platform against unauthorized access, providing users with a secure environment for their creative endeavors.
  • Collaborative Tools: Depositphotos integrates collaborative tools that facilitate teamwork and project management. These features streamline communication between users, contributors, and clients, enhancing the overall collaborative experience within the platform.
Technology AspectFunctionality
Search AlgorithmsEnhanced content discovery through advanced machine learning.
Cloud-Based StorageScalable and accessible storage for an extensive content library.
Responsive DesignOptimal user experience across various devices and screen sizes.

By leveraging these technological advancements, Depositphotos not only delivers an efficient and user-friendly platform but also stays at the forefront of the digital content industry. The integration of innovative technologies underscores Depositphotos’ commitment to providing a seamless and contemporary experience for its users.

User Experience and Interface

The success of Depositphotos is not only attributed to its vast content library but also to its user-friendly interface, fostering an enriching experience for both content creators and consumers. Let’s explore the key elements that contribute to the positive user experience on Depositphotos:

  • Intuitive Navigation: Depositphotos features an intuitive and well-organized interface that allows users to navigate seamlessly through its extensive content categories. The user-friendly design ensures that even first-time visitors can quickly find and explore the content they need.
  • Efficient Search Functionality: The platform’s search functionality is robust, offering advanced filters, keyword suggestions, and sorting options. Users can refine their searches with precision, saving time and enhancing the overall efficiency of content discovery.
  • Preview and Selection Tools: Depositphotos provides users with comprehensive preview options, including zoom functionality and watermarked previews. This enables users to assess the quality and suitability of the content before making a selection, ensuring confidence in their choices.
  • Collaboration Features: Designed to cater to collaborative projects, Depositphotos integrates features that facilitate teamwork. Users can create and share collections, making it easier for teams to collaborate on content selection and project planning.
  • Responsive Design: The platform’s responsive design ensures a consistent and optimal experience across various devices. Whether accessed from a desktop, tablet, or mobile phone, Depositphotos adapts seamlessly to different screen sizes, providing a consistent and enjoyable user experience.
User Experience ElementKey Features
Intuitive NavigationWell-organized interface for easy content exploration.
Efficient Search FunctionalityAdvanced filters, keyword suggestions, and sorting options for precise searches.
Collaboration FeaturesCollection creation and sharing for seamless teamwork.

Depositphotos places a premium on ensuring that users not only access a vast array of content but also enjoy a streamlined and enjoyable journey while doing so. The user-centric design and features contribute to Depositphotos’ reputation as a preferred platform for creative professionals and enthusiasts alike.

Collaboration and Contributor Insights

At the heart of Depositphotos is a thriving ecosystem of collaboration between the platform and its contributors. This symbiotic relationship plays a pivotal role in the continuous growth and richness of the content library. Here’s a closer look at how collaboration and contributor insights shape the Depositphotos experience:

  • Diverse Contributor Community: Depositphotos collaborates with a diverse community of contributors, including photographers, illustrators, and videographers from various corners of the globe. This diversity ensures a broad spectrum of visual styles and subject matter, enriching the overall content available to users.
  • Submission Guidelines and Quality Standards: Contributors adhere to Depositphotos’ submission guidelines and quality standards to ensure that the content meets the platform’s criteria. This rigorous process contributes to maintaining a high level of quality and relevance within the content library.
  • Real-time Performance Insights: Depositphotos provides contributors with real-time insights into the performance of their uploaded content. Contributors can track downloads, views, and user engagement, gaining valuable feedback that aids in refining their creative strategies.
  • Rewards and Recognition: Successful collaboration is acknowledged through various reward mechanisms. Depositphotos recognizes and rewards contributors for the popularity and impact of their content, fostering a positive and mutually beneficial relationship.
  • Community Engagement: The platform facilitates community engagement among contributors, fostering a sense of camaraderie. Forums, events, and collaborative projects provide contributors with opportunities to connect, share insights, and learn from each other’s experiences.
Collaboration AspectKey Features
Diverse Contributor CommunityCollaboration with photographers, illustrators, and videographers globally.
Submission GuidelinesRigorous adherence to guidelines and quality standards for content submissions.
Rewards and RecognitionAcknowledgment and rewards for popular and impactful contributions.

Depositphotos’ commitment to nurturing collaboration and providing contributors with valuable insights contributes not only to the success of individual creators but also to the overall vibrancy and diversity of the platform’s content offerings. This collaborative spirit underscores Depositphotos’ role as a dynamic and supportive hub for both creators and consumers of digital content.


Here are answers to some frequently asked questions about Depositphotos, helping you navigate the platform with ease:

  • Q: How can I download content from Depositphotos?

    A: To download content, you need to create an account on Depositphotos. Once logged in, find the desired file, select the appropriate license, and click the download button. The high-resolution file will be instantly available for use in your projects.

  • Q: What types of licenses does Depositphotos offer?

    A: Depositphotos provides various licenses to accommodate different usage scenarios. Standard licenses are suitable for general purposes, while extended licenses offer broader usage rights. Additionally, the platform offers exclusive and non-exclusive licensing options.

  • Q: Can I use Depositphotos content for commercial purposes?

    A: Yes, Depositphotos offers commercial licenses that allow users to use content for promotional and advertising purposes. Ensure you select the appropriate license that aligns with your intended commercial use.

  • Q: What is the process for becoming a contributor on Depositphotos?

    A: To become a contributor, you can apply through the Depositphotos website. Once approved, you can start submitting your content following the platform’s submission guidelines and quality standards.

  • Q: How does Depositphotos ensure the quality of its content?

    A: Depositphotos maintains quality through a rigorous review process. All submitted content is evaluated for technical aspects, licensing compliance, and overall aesthetic quality. This ensures that only high-quality content is included in the platform’s library.

These FAQs provide valuable insights into the essential aspects of using Depositphotos, ensuring a smooth and informed experience for both new and existing users. If you have further questions, feel free to explore the Depositphotos support resources or contact their customer service for assistance.


Embarking on this exploration of Depositphotos has offered a comprehensive glimpse into the inner workings of this dynamic platform. From the vast content collection process to the intricacies of licensing, technology, and collaborative efforts, Depositphotos stands as a versatile hub for digital creatives.

As we’ve uncovered, Depositphotos’ commitment to quality, diversity, and user experience positions it as a valuable resource for individuals and businesses alike. The platform’s advanced technology, intuitive interface, and collaborative features contribute to a seamless and enjoyable creative journey.

Whether you’re a content creator leveraging the platform for exposure and recognition or a user seeking high-quality visuals for your projects, Depositphotos caters to a wide range of needs. The collaboration with a global network of contributors ensures a rich and diverse content library that reflects various artistic perspectives.

By maintaining a balance between user-friendly design and advanced technological solutions, Depositphotos not only simplifies the process of content discovery but also sets a standard for the digital content industry. The flexible licensing options and transparent usage rights empower users to navigate the platform confidently, knowing they have access to a vast array of high-quality content for their creative endeavors.

In conclusion, Depositphotos stands as more than just a repository of digital assets; it is a dynamic ecosystem that fosters creativity, collaboration, and innovation. Whether you’re a seasoned professional or a newcomer in the creative landscape, Depositphotos offers a gateway to a world of possibilities, enriching projects and elevating the overall creative experience.

Are you human?

Double click any of the below ads and after that, reload the page and you can Download Your Image!